CLUTCH SYSTEM
CLUTCH MASTER CYLINDER
REMOVAL
Drain the clutch fluid from the hydraulic system.
Remove the clutch upper oil bolt.
Remove the rear view mirror.
Disconnect the clutch switch wires.
Remove the master cylinder holder and clutch
master cylinder.
CAUTION
A void spilling clutch fluid on painted surfaces.
Place a rag over the fuel tank whenever the
clutch system is serviced.
NOTE:
When removing the oil bolt, cover the end of
the hose to prevent contamination and secure
the hose.
DISASSEMBLY
Remove the clutch lever and remove the clutch
switch.
Remove the push rod and boot.
